To receive Bitcoin Cash, simply provide the sender with your Bitcoin Cash address. How do I know what my Bitcoin Cash address is?
You can find out your Bitcoin Cash address by opening your Bitcoin Cash wallet.

Every digital wallet is a little different, but your Bitcoin Cash address will always be displayed somewhere within the wallet.
Here's an example of a Bitcoin Cash address:
bitcoincash:pqx5ej6z9cvxc2c7nw5p4s5kf8nzmzc5cqapu8xprq
An address can also be displayed as a QR code. For example:

How can I let people know what my Bitcoin Cash address is?
Your digital wallet will allow you to copy your Bitcoin Cash address to your clipboard. Then, you just need to provide the sender with that address via email, messaging app, SMS, etc.
Most wallets also provide you with a QR-code version of your Bitcoin Cash address. If you're in the same room as the sender, they can scan your QR code to get your address.
Can I receive bitcoin cash to a centralized cryptocurrency exchange?
If you are using a centralized cryptocurrency exchange, the process is the same as above (ie. find your Bitcoin Cash address and provide it to the sender).
Note that receiving bitcoin cash to your cryptocurrency exchange wallet usually takes quite a bit longer than receiving your bitcoin cash to a 'self-custodial' wallet you control. This is because centralized exchanges don't allow you to directly interact with the Bitcoin Cash network.

Is it safe to give out my Bitcoin Cash address?
You can safely give out your Bitcoin Cash address to friends, family, and acquaintances. No one can steal your bitcoin cash unless they have both your address and the private key to it. However, you should know that, since the Bitcoin Cash network is publicly viewable, anyone who knows your Bitcoin Cash address can easily find out exactly how much bitcoin cash you have at that address by simply pasting the address into a Bitcoin Cash block explorer like this one. They can also see every transaction you've ever made using that address. If you don't want people to see this information, you'll need to use a fresh Bitcoin Cash address. Luckily, that's easy to do!
